Factors to Consider When Choosing a Compact Posture Cushion for Travel Work**

When you’re on the move, choosing a cushion that’s lightweight and portable makes packing a breeze while still giving you solid seat support.

Opt for an ergonomic shape with supportive contours, breathable fabric, and durable construction to keep you comfortable on long flights or in the office.

And pick a model with an effortless setup—like a quick fold‑out or self‑inflating feature—so you spend less time assembling and more time using.

Ergonomic Design Features

Because your spine demands targeted support, a compact cushion that follows an S‑shaped contour will naturally align your lower back with the seat. This shape positions the lumbar region at the precise spot where your tailbone meets the chair, reducing pressure points. Its core uses high‑density memory foam paired with gel inserts, spreading load evenly and keeping the cushion flat over long periods. Adjustable firmness lets you fine‑tune support through built‑in inflation, removable layers, or twist‑together hinges, so you match your own spinal alignment. The design stays lightweight—under 2 lb—and folds to roughly 20 × 15 × 3 inches, making it travel‑ready. A non‑slip base and ventilated mesh top keep it stable and cool while you sit. With these ergonomic features, you keep posture healthy wherever you work daily.

Washable and Hygienic

Every compact travel cushion you pick should feature a removable cover made from 100 % polyester or TPU that you can machine‑wash at 40 °C without distortion. Inside, look for a sealed gel or dense foam that won’t soak up sweat, keeping the outer layer dry and clean. Ventilated or mesh panels let moisture evaporate within an hour, toughening bacteria growth. Many models add antimicrobial or silver‑ion coatings to curb germs, especially if you travel often. Clean the cover with a quick sanitizing rinse or a dash of vinegar, then air‑dry or tumble on low heat to ward off mildew and boost durability. Do Airlines Limit the Use of Inflatable Lumbar Pillows on Flights?

Most airlines let you bring inflatable lumbar pillows, but check size limits and verify it’s fully deflated before boarding. Many carriers won’t mind if it’s carried in hand luggage; some may require it to be in a clear bag. Just make sure it’s not over 22×14×8 inches, and never inflate it inside the cabin. Always confirm your airline’s policy before you travel and you’ll avoid any surprises to guarantee comfort.
